Job Description
The CAM Surface Field Specialist is responsible for providing customers with safe, accurate and on-time product and service delivery.
Successful Position holders are excellent communicators, enjoy solving problems, and work well both independently and in a team.
In this position, you will be working on Cameron products and services. Cameron is part of the SLB product family and is a leading provider of flow equipment products, systems, and services to worldwide oil, gas, and process industries.
Roles and Responsibilities:
- Performing specified service work on SLB equipment.
- Executing and rendering assistance to the customer during the installation and testing of the equipment.
- If required, execution of maintenance, troubleshooting, repair, assembly and testing activities at Customer’s location or in the Workshop.
- In case of non-conformances/malfunctions of SLB products at Customer’s location, reporting the non-conformances by utilizing the Corporate Field Performance Report procedure (intranet).
- Reporting progress/completion of work to the Service Engineer and or customer, utilizing Service Tickets and separate reports.
- Execute proper housekeeping.
- To become familiar with company products, design principles and safety aspects.
- Execution and proper paper processing of Field service orders, spare parts used and rental tooling handling, back load and Customer chargeable utilization.
- Ensuring of proper execution of Customer orders in relation to QHSE, SLB procedures and best work practice in the industry.
- Performing maintenance and preservation of equipment and tools as per procedures with use of preservation materials.
- Unboxing and boxing of equipment and tools.
- Unloading and loading of equipment and units.
- Preparation of equipment and tools as per procedure.
- Cleaning washing of equipment and tools and work area with high pressure washing gear.
- Moving and changing location of equipment and tools with using of crane or forklift by means of rigging/slinging techniques according with certificates.
- Protects the health, safety & property of our employees, our customers, our contractors & third parties.
- Protects the environment in the communities where we live and work.
- Develops QHSE understanding and experience through training available.
Qualifications and Experience:
- Bachelor's degree in petroleum engineering or a related field.
- 1-3 years of experience in drilling or mechanical operations.
- Experience in wellhead equipment.
- Knowledge for installation wellhead, X- tree, hangers and etc.
- Technical knowledge to install/repair valves.
- Experience for pressure testing equipment.
- BOSIET/ offshore survival certification is advantage.
- Offshore experience is advantageous.
- Fluency in written and spoken English (B2 or higher level).
- Commitment to safe working practices, policies and legislation.
